The Importance of Breath in Yoga


Breath is the foundation of yoga. It serves as a bridge between the mind and body, allowing us to cultivate awareness and presence. In yoga, breath control, or pranayama, is essential for achieving a deeper state of relaxation and focus. By learning to control our breath, we can influence our mental and emotional states, leading to a more balanced life.


Benefits of Yoga Breathing


Engaging in yoga breathing exercises can provide numerous benefits, including:


  • Reduced Stress: Deep, intentional breathing activates the body's relaxation response, helping to lower cortisol levels and reduce stress.

  • Improved Focus: Concentrating on your breath can enhance mental clarity and focus, making it easier to tackle daily challenges.

  • Enhanced Emotional Regulation: Breathwork can help manage emotions, allowing for a more balanced and composed response to life's ups and downs.

  • Increased Energy: Proper breathing techniques can boost oxygen flow to the body, increasing energy levels and vitality.

Techniques to Explore in Online Classes


Once you find a class that suits your needs, you can explore various breathing techniques that can enhance your practice. Here are a few popular methods:


Diaphragmatic Breathing


Also known as abdominal or belly breathing, this technique involves engaging the diaphragm to take deep breaths. It helps increase lung capacity and promotes relaxation.


How to Practice:

  1. Sit or lie down comfortably.

  2. Place one hand on your chest and the other on your abdomen.

  3. Inhale deeply through your nose, allowing your abdomen to rise while keeping your chest still.

  4. Exhale slowly through your mouth, feeling your abdomen fall.


Box Breathing


Box breathing is a simple yet effective technique that involves inhaling, holding, exhaling, and holding the breath again for equal counts. This method can help calm the mind and improve focus.


How to Practice:

  1. Inhale through your nose for a count of four.

  2. Hold your breath for a count of four.

  3. Exhale through your mouth for a count of four.

  4. Hold your breath again for a count of four.

  5. Repeat for several cycles.


Alternate Nostril Breathing


This technique balances the body's energy and promotes mental clarity. It involves breathing through one nostril at a time.


How to Practice:

  1. Sit comfortably and close your right nostril with your right thumb.

  2. Inhale deeply through your left nostril.

  3. Close your left nostril with your right ring finger and release your right nostril.

  4. Exhale through your right nostril.

  5. Inhale through your right nostril, then switch and exhale through your left.

  6. Continue alternating for several cycles.


Creating a Supportive Environment


To maximize the benefits of your online yoga breathing classes, it's essential to create a supportive environment. Here are some tips to enhance your practice:


Choose a Quiet Space


Find a quiet area in your home where you can practice without distractions. This could be a dedicated yoga space or simply a corner of your living room.


Use Props


Consider using props such as yoga blocks, cushions, or blankets to support your practice. These can enhance comfort and help you achieve better alignment during breathing exercises.


Set an Intention


Before each session, take a moment to set an intention for your practice. This could be a word or phrase that resonates with you, such as "calm," "focus," or "gratitude." Setting an intention can help guide your practice and deepen your experience.


Incorporating Breathing Techniques into Daily Life


While online yoga breathing classes provide structured guidance, you can also incorporate these techniques into your daily routine. Here are some practical ways to do so:


Morning Ritual


Start your day with a few minutes of deep breathing. This can help set a positive tone for the day ahead and enhance your focus.


Mindful Breaks


Take short breaks throughout the day to practice breathing exercises. This can help reduce stress and improve your overall well-being.


Pre-Sleep Routine


Incorporate breathing techniques into your bedtime routine to promote relaxation and prepare your body for sleep. This can lead to a more restful night.
